ホームページ >バックエンド開発 >PHPチュートリアル >PHP フォーム Web ページにフォームを挿入する

PHP フォーム Web ページにフォームを挿入する

伊谢尔伦
伊谢尔伦オリジナル
2017-04-18 13:20:572811ブラウズ

通常の WEB ページへのフォームの挿入は次のとおりです。 ここでは比較的完全なフォームが作成され、基本的にすべての要素と 属性

に表示されます。

まず、HTML の

タグに
フォームを追加します。

次に、一連のフォーム要素と属性を

フォームに追加します。ここでは、友人にページをよりクールに見せるために、いくつかの CSS スタイルがフォーム タグに追加されています。
<!DOCTYPE html>
<html lang="en">
<head>
  <meta charset="UTF-8">
  <title>Document</title>
</head>
<body>
<form action="index.php" method="post" name="form1" enctype="multipart/form-data">
  <table width="400" border="1" cellpadding="1"  bgcolor="#999999">
    <tr bgcolor="#FFCC33">
      <td width="103" height="25" align="right">姓名:</td>
      <td height="25">
        <input name="user" type="text" id="user" size="20" maxlength="100">
      </td>
    </tr>
    <tr bgcolor="#FFCC33">
      <td height="25" align="right">性别:</td>
      <td height="25" colspan="2" align="left">
        <input name="sex" type="radio" value="男" checked>男
            <input name="sex" type="radio" value="女" >女
         </td>
    </tr>
    <tr bgcolor="#FFCC33">
      <td width="103" height="25" align="right">密码:</td>
      <td width="289" height="25" colspan="2" align="left">
        <input name="pwd" type="password" id="pwd" size="20" maxlength="100">
      </td>
    </tr>
    <tr bgcolor="#FFCC33">
      <td height="25" align="right">学历:</td>
      <td height="25" colspan="2" align="left">
        <select name="select">
          <option value="专科">专科</option>
          <option value="本科" selected>本科</option>
          <option value="高中">高中</option>
        </select>
      </td>
    </tr>
    <tr bgcolor="#FFCC33">
      <td height="25" align="right">爱好:</td>
      <td height="25" colspan="2" align="left">
        <input name="fond[]" type="checkbox" id="fond[]" value="音乐">音乐
            <input name="fond[]" type="checkbox" id="fond[]" value="体育">体育
            <input name="fond[]" type="checkbox" id="fond[]" value="美术">美术
         </td>
    </tr>
    <tr bgcolor="#FFCC33">
      <td height="25" align="right">照片上传:</td>
      <td height="25" colspan="2">
        <input name="image" type="file" id="image" size="20" maxlength="100">
      </td>
    </tr>
    <tr bgcolor="#FFCC33">
      <td height="25" align="right">个人简介:</td>
      <td height="25" colspan="2">
        <textarea name="intro" cols="30" rows="10" id="intro"></textarea>
      </td>
    </tr>
    <tr align="center" bgcolor="#FFCC33">
      <td height="25" colspan="3">
        <input type="submit" name="submit" value="提交">
        <input type="reset" name="reset" value="重置">
      </td>
    </tr>
  </table>
</form>
</body>
</html>

説明: このフォームには、一般的なフォーム要素: 単一行テキスト ボックス、複数行テキスト ボックス、単一オプション (ラジオ)、複数オプション (チェックボックス)、および複数選択メニューが含まれています。

maxlength は、名前とパスワードのテキスト ボックスに関連付けられた属性で、ユーザーのパスワードの最大長を 100 文字に制限します。

リストボックスはリストメニューであり、その名前付き属性には選択用の独自の値があります。 Selected は特定の属性選択要素です。オプションがこの属性に関連付けられている場合、その項目は表示時に最初の項目としてリストされます。

イントロテキストボックスのコンテンツには、行と列に応じてテキスト、行、列の幅が表示されます。

チェックされたタグは、デフォルトで選択されている単一オプションおよび複数オプションの特定の値を参照します。

このファイルを index.phppage として保存します。

上記のファイルのフォームフォームはPOSTメソッドを使用してデータを転送するため、ユーザーが送信したデータは$_POSTまたは$_REQUESTのスーパーグローバル配列に保存され、その値に基づいて送信を処理できます。 $_POST 配列内。フォームデータの取得方法については後ほど詳しく紹介します。POSTメソッドはmethod=”post”で選択します。フォームはフォームデータを取得する際のアプリケーションの最も基本的な操作ですので、フォームの後ろにあるコース紹介に注目してください。

注: このページは PHP スクリプトを使用していないため、静的 ページです。.html 形式で保存し、ブラウザを使用して直接ファイルを開いて実行結果を表示できます。

ブラウザにアドレスを入力してEnterキーを押します。実行結果は次のようになります。

PHP フォーム Web ページにフォームを挿入する

どうでしょうか?感覚的にはもう少し眩しく見えませんか?友達は自分でさらにコードを入力して試すことができます。

以上がPHP フォーム Web ページにフォームを挿入するの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。